Student Performance Analysis for Educators

The analysis of student performance is an integral part of an educator’s job as it lays the groundwork for the development of strategies that can enhance learning outcomes. With today’s rapid advancement in technology, educators have access to a variety of tools and resources to assist in this process. Among these are educational materials, tailored according to varying pedagogies and student learning styles, which provide invaluable insights into how students absorb information and which methods may be most effective in improving understanding. Furthermore, chatbots are increasingly being used as an additional tool to track and analyze student performance and participation. These AI-driven programs offer invaluable real-time insights for teachers by engaging with students conversationally, addressing their queries, and gauging their comprehension of topics and subjects. They also provide an interactive platform where students can express their thoughts, ideas, and areas of struggle, thus offering educators an in-depth understanding of specific areas where individual students may need additional support or guidance. Classroom Management and Student Experience Improvements

Artificial Intelligence (AI) is significantly influencing classroom management and the enhancement of student experiences. AI’s application engenders a more personalized, interactive, and engaging experience for students, promoting better comprehension and retention of knowledge. Through AI’s potential to analyze vast learning behavior data, teachers can identify individual student’s strengths and weaknesses, thereby tailoring their teaching strategies to accommodate diverse learning styles. Moreover, AI is integral in automating administrative tasks, thus allowing educators more time to focus on student-oriented tasks and reducing their workload—a critical aspect of effective classroom management. The predictive analysis capability of AI can also assist educators in adequately planning and adjusting teaching material, ensuring continual student engagement and fostering a more conducive learning environment.
